The Best Cloud Data Migration Tools for Seamless Transitions
In today's digital age, cloud data migration has become an essential process for businesses looking to adapt and optimize their operations. As companies continue to move away from on-premises storage solutions, the need for efficient and reliable cloud data migration tools has never been more crucial. In this article, we will explore the best cloud data migration tools available and discuss their importance, challenges, and future trends.
Understanding Cloud Data Migration
Before we delve into the world of cloud data migration tools, it is important to have a clear understanding of what this process entails. Cloud data migration refers to the movement of data from traditional infrastructure to the cloud, either from on-premises servers or from one cloud provider to another.
Cloud data migration offers numerous benefits such as scalability, cost-efficiency, and improved data accessibility. However, the process itself can be complex and time-consuming.
The Importance of Cloud Data Migration
Cloud data migration plays a vital role in enabling businesses to leverage the full potential of cloud computing. By migrating data to the cloud, organizations can take advantage of enhanced scalability, flexibility, and security offered by cloud service providers.
Moreover, cloud data migration enables businesses to optimize their operations by streamlining workflows, reducing costs, and improving collaboration. It allows for seamless integration with various cloud-based applications, enabling businesses to stay ahead in today's competitive market.
Key Challenges in Cloud Data Migration
While cloud data migration offers numerous benefits, it also presents unique challenges that organizations must overcome to ensure a successful transition. One of the major challenges is the risk of data loss or corruption during the migration process.
Another challenge is the compatibility between different cloud platforms and data formats. Organizations may face difficulties in transferring data between on-premises systems and cloud platforms due to differences in data structures and storage technologies.
Furthermore, organizations must consider the potential disruption to ongoing operations during the migration process. Downtime, performance issues, and data inaccessibility can have a significant impact on the business if not properly managed.
Additionally, organizations need to carefully plan and strategize their cloud data migration to ensure a smooth transition. This involves conducting a thorough assessment of the existing infrastructure, data dependencies, and potential risks. It is crucial to develop a comprehensive migration plan that includes data backup strategies, testing procedures, and contingency plans to mitigate any unforeseen issues.
Furthermore, data security and compliance are paramount considerations during cloud data migration. Organizations must ensure that data is encrypted during transit and at rest, and that proper access controls and authentication mechanisms are in place to protect sensitive information. Compliance with industry regulations and data protection laws is also essential to avoid legal and reputational risks.
In conclusion, cloud data migration is a critical process that enables businesses to harness the benefits of cloud computing. While it presents challenges, careful planning, and implementation can help organizations overcome these obstacles and achieve a successful migration. By embracing cloud data migration, businesses can unlock new opportunities for growth, innovation, and competitive advantage in today's digital landscape.
Evaluating Cloud Data Migration Tools
When it comes to selecting the best cloud data migration tool for your business, there are several factors to consider. These factors will ensure a smooth migration process and minimize any potential risks or challenges.
First and foremost, it is essential to assess the compatibility of the migration tool with your existing infrastructure and target cloud platform. The tool should support a wide range of data formats, databases, and cloud providers to ensure a seamless transfer.
Additionally, consider the scalability and performance capabilities of the tool. Ensure that it can handle large volumes of data and has built-in mechanisms to optimize data transfer speed and minimize downtime.
Furthermore, evaluate the reliability and reputation of the tool vendor. Look for customer reviews and testimonials to gain insights into their track record and customer satisfaction levels.
But what about the impact of data migration on your business operations? It's crucial to consider the potential disruptions and downtime that may occur during the migration process. A reliable migration tool should provide options for scheduling the migration during off-peak hours to minimize any negative impact on your business.
Moreover, it's worth noting that data security is of utmost importance in today's digital landscape. Look for a migration tool that offers robust data encryption techniques to ensure the confidentiality and integrity of your transferred data. This will provide peace of mind knowing that your sensitive information is protected.
Common Features of Top Migration Tools
While different cloud data migration tools may have unique features, there are some common functionalities that top tools often possess.
One of the key features is data encryption and security. A reliable migration tool should offer robust encryption techniques to ensure the confidentiality and integrity of the transferred data.
Automated scheduling and monitoring capabilities are also important features to look for. These features allow for efficient management of the migration process, enabling organizations to track the progress and identify any potential issues in real-time.
Moreover, an intuitive user interface and ease of use are crucial factors when evaluating migration tools. The tool should provide a user-friendly interface and require minimal technical expertise to operate effectively.
But what about data validation? It's essential to ensure the accuracy and completeness of the migrated data. Look for a migration tool that offers comprehensive data validation features, such as data integrity checks and error reporting. This will help you identify and resolve any data inconsistencies or errors that may arise during the migration process.
Furthermore, consider the availability of technical support and training resources. A reputable migration tool vendor should provide excellent customer support and offer comprehensive documentation, tutorials, and training materials to assist you throughout the migration process.
In conclusion, selecting the right cloud data migration tool requires careful consideration of various factors, including compatibility, scalability, reliability, security, and ease of use. By evaluating these factors and considering the additional features mentioned above, you can make an informed decision that will ensure a successful and efficient migration process for your business.
Top Cloud Data Migration Tools
Now that we have explored the importance, challenges, and evaluation criteria of cloud data migration tools, let's dive into some of the top tools available in the market.
Overview of Leading Migration Tools
1. AWS Data Migration Service (DMS): AWS Data Migration Service (DMS) offers a comprehensive solution for cloud data migration with its advanced features and extensive compatibility. It supports seamless migration across various cloud platforms and ensures data integrity throughout the process.
2. Azure Data Migration Service: Azure Data Migration Service is renowned for its scalability and high-performance capabilities. It excels in handling large-scale data migrations and offers real-time monitoring and reporting to track the migration progress.
3. Google Cloud Migrate: Google Cloud Migrate stands out for its user-friendly interface and ease of use. It simplifies the migration process and offers robust security features to protect sensitive data during the transfer.
Pros and Cons of Each Tool
While all of the above tools have their strengths, it is important to consider the pros and cons of each to find the best fit for your business.
AWS Data Migration Service (DMS) offers robust security features and extensive compatibility but may have a steeper learning curve for less technical users.
Azure Data Migration Service excels in performance and scalability, but it may come with a higher price tag compared to other options.
Google Cloud Migrate is user-friendly and offers simplified migration, but it may lack some advanced functionalities required by more complex migration scenarios.
Now, let's take a closer look at each tool and explore some additional details that can help you make an informed decision:
AWS Data Migration Service (DMS) not only ensures data integrity during the migration process but also provides advanced data mapping capabilities. This feature allows you to easily map and transform data from the source to the target cloud platform, ensuring a smooth and accurate migration. Additionally, AWS Data Migration Service (DMS) offers comprehensive documentation and support resources, making it easier for users to navigate through any challenges they may encounter.
When it comes to Azure Data Migration Service, its real-time monitoring and reporting capabilities are worth highlighting. This feature allows you to track the progress of your data migration in real-time, providing valuable insights into the performance and efficiency of the migration process. Moreover, Azure Data Migration Service offers customizable dashboards and alerts, enabling you to stay informed about any potential issues or bottlenecks that may arise during the migration.
While Google Cloud Migrate may lack some advanced functionalities, it compensates for it with its intuitive user interface. The tool prioritizes simplicity and ease of use, making it an ideal choice for businesses with less technical expertise. Additionally, Google Cloud Migrate provides a seamless onboarding process, offering step-by-step guidance and tutorials to ensure a smooth transition to the new cloud environment.
By considering these additional details, you can gain a deeper understanding of the unique strengths and features offered by each tool. This knowledge will empower you to choose the cloud data migration tool that best aligns with your business requirements and objectives.
Tips for a Seamless Cloud Data Migration
Now that you have a deeper understanding of cloud data migration and the available tools, let's discuss some tips to ensure a smooth and successful migration process.
When it comes to data migration, prioritizing data cleansing and de-duplication is crucial. By thoroughly cleaning and removing any unnecessary or redundant data, you can ensure the accuracy and integrity of the migrated data. This not only optimizes storage but also maintains data quality throughout the migration.
Another best practice for a seamless migration is to develop a clear migration plan and schedule. Breaking down the migration process into smaller, manageable tasks allows for better organization and allocation of resources. It is essential to allocate sufficient time for testing and validation before finalizing the migration to minimize any potential issues or conflicts.
Effective communication and collaboration with all stakeholders involved in the migration process is also vital. By ensuring that everyone is on the same page regarding expectations, timelines, and potential impacts, you can minimize disruptions to ongoing operations. Regular updates and open lines of communication help create a sense of transparency and trust among the team.
Avoiding Common Migration Pitfalls
Performing thorough testing and validation before the final migration is a critical step in avoiding common migration pitfalls. By creating a testing environment that closely mirrors the production environment, you can identify and resolve any potential issues or conflicts before they impact the live system. This approach minimizes surprises and ensures a smoother transition.
Backing up your data before the migration is like having a safety net. In case any data loss or corruption occurs during the migration process, you can rely on the backup to restore the data. This precautionary measure provides peace of mind and safeguards against any unforeseen circumstances.
Monitoring the migration progress closely is essential to stay on top of any challenges or delays that may arise. Having a contingency plan in place allows you to address these issues proactively, minimizing downtime and keeping the business running smoothly. Regular checkpoints and progress reports help ensure that the migration stays on track.
By following these tips and best practices, you can enhance the overall success of your cloud data migration. Remember, a well-executed migration not only ensures a seamless transition but also sets the stage for future growth and scalability in the cloud.
Future Trends in Cloud Data Migration
As technology continues to evolve, so does the landscape of cloud data migration. Let's explore some emerging trends that are shaping the future of data migration.
One of the emerging technologies in data migration is the use of artificial intelligence (AI) and machine learning (ML) algorithms to automate and optimize the migration process. AI can analyze data structures and dependencies to identify the most efficient migration strategy.
Another trend is the adoption of containerization technologies such as Docker and Kubernetes. Containers provide an isolated environment for applications and data, making it easier to migrate and manage complex application architectures.
Emerging Technologies in Data Migration
Artificial intelligence and machine learning are revolutionizing the way businesses approach data migration. These technologies not only automate the migration process but also enhance decision-making capabilities. By leveraging AI and ML algorithms, businesses can analyze vast amounts of data, identify patterns, and make data-driven decisions to ensure a seamless migration experience.
Moreover, containerization technologies like Docker and Kubernetes are gaining popularity in the field of data migration. These technologies offer a lightweight and portable solution for packaging applications and their dependencies. By encapsulating applications in containers, businesses can ensure consistency across different environments and simplify the migration process.
The Future of Cloud Data Migration
The future of cloud data migration holds exciting possibilities for businesses. With advancements in AI, we can expect more intelligent and automated migration tools that can handle complex scenarios with minimal human intervention.
Furthermore, the rise of hybrid and multi-cloud architectures will require migration tools that can seamlessly transfer data across different cloud platforms, providing businesses with greater flexibility and scalability. As organizations increasingly adopt a multi-cloud strategy to leverage the strengths of different cloud providers, migration tools will play a crucial role in ensuring smooth data transfer and integration.
Additionally, data migration will become more closely integrated with other technologies, such as data analytics and machine learning, enabling businesses to gain valuable insights and leverage the full potential of their migrated data. By combining data migration with advanced analytics capabilities, organizations can unlock hidden patterns and trends in their data, enabling them to make informed business decisions and drive innovation.
In conclusion, cloud data migration is an essential process for businesses looking to unlock the full potential of cloud computing. By carefully evaluating and selecting the best migration tool, businesses can ensure a smooth transition with minimal disruption. With the right tools and best practices, organizations can take advantage of the numerous benefits offered by the cloud and stay ahead in today's fast-paced digital landscape.